Stabilization of He/sub 2/(A/sup 3/. sigma. /sub u//sup +/) molecules in liquid helium by optical pumping for vacuum uv laser

Patent ·
OSTI ID:6444083
A technique is disclosed for achieving large populations of metastable spin-aligned He/sub 2/(a/sup 3/..sigma../sub u//sup +/) molecules in superfluid helium to obtain lasing in the vacuum ultraviolet wavelength regime around 0.0800 ..mu..m by electronically exciting liquid (superfluid) helium with a comparatively low-current electron beam (100 to 200 keV), less than or equal to 10 ..mu..A) and spin aligning the metastable molecules by means of optical pumping with a modestly-powered (100 mW) circularly-polarized cw laser operating at, for example, 0.9096 or 0.4650 ..mu..m. Once a high concentration of spin-aligned He/sub 2/(a/sup 3/..sigma../sub u//sup +/) is achieved with lifetimes of a few milliseconds, a strong microwave signal destroys the spin alignment and induces a quick collisional transition of He/sub 2/(a/sup 3/..sigma../sub u//sup +/) molecules to the A/sup 1/..sigma../sub u//sup +/ state and thereby a lasing transition to the X/sup 1/..sigma..g/sup +/ state.
